6. Radar cross section
• RCS is an estimate of observability of a target, which in turn,
depends on its external features and properties.
• Ability to reflect radar signal
• Related to
oPhysical geometry
oDirection of radar signal
oFrequency of radar signal
oMaterial of aircraft
9. RCS reduction techniques-
• RCSR prevents or delays detection by radar.
• RCSR prevents or makes a correct target classification
difficult.
• RCSR prevents the lock-on of radar seeker heads or
reduces thelock-on distance.
• RCSR increases the protective range of ECM.
10. RCS reduction techniques-
• There are four basic techniques for reducing radar cross
section:
o Shaping;
o Radar absorbing materials (RAM);
o Passive cancellation;
o Active cancellation.

16. Passive Cancellation
• In passive cancellation, the basic concept is to introduce an
echo source whose amplitude and phase can be adjusted to
cancel another echo source.
